Java/fiori/ui5/odata/abap Developer Resume
5.00/5 (Submit Your Rating)
SUMMARY:
- 11 years of experience as Java/Fiori/UI5/Odata/ABAP developer in implementation in Retail and Logistics domain.
- Providing clients with Custom UI5 solutions, extending out of the box Fiori applications, migration of WebDynpro Java solution to Fiori application, Creation of Odata services, debugging functional modules and various upgrade projects.
- Overall completed 7 implementation lifecycles with Customers worldwide.
- Have worked in small and large teams and always have been acknowledge as a responsible team player and lead.
- Experienced in working closely with the client for requirements gathering, suggest improvments, design, prototype, develop and deliver while ensuring highest standards are maintained in development.
- Hands - on experience in designing and developing responsive UI5 application integrating Gateway Odata/JSON. Maintaining very high UX standards and Fiori design guidelines for seamless user experience.
- Strong Proficiency in JavaScript, HTML,JQuery, CSS.
- Strong proficiency in debugging tools to debug UI5/Fiori applications as well as Gateway Odata and ABAP BAPI/Custom RFCs.
- NetWeaver gateway Odata service design - like Entities, Deep entities, Associations, implementing CURD methods, Data dictionary.
- Strong proficiency in SAP Netweaver gateway framework and Odata web services.
- Strong proficiency in configuration the Fiori Launch Pad, Catalog, Tiles, Group, Semantic Objects
- Experience in developing Fiori Launchpad and configuration
- Experience and understanding SAP BASIS and security parts in terms of SAP Fiori
- Fiori package configuration on SAP NW Gateway and backend ECC App configuration
- Customization and extension of Fiori Apps.
- Strong proficiency in using SAP Web IDE, Eclipse tools, GitHub, Cordova for mobile apps
- Extensive knowledge of WD Java and NW Portal which is helpful in converting WDJava/ABAP application to UI5
- Extensive knowledge of tools like SAP splash build and design stencil to create state of the art wireframes.
PROFESSIONAL EXPERIENCE:
Confidential
Java/Fiori/UI5/Odata/ABAP developerResponsibilities:
- Responsible for designing, supporting and independently completing project tasks
- Developed/designed Fiori like applications for material management domain
- Helped configure out of the box Fiori applications
- Created custom Odata models
- Developed code to implement mobile camera as a barcode scanner
- Developed a custom SAP UI5 mobile application for emergency contacts with call options
- Managed the fiori launchpad designer
- Enhanced existing FI and HR applications using webdynpro java
Confidential
Java/Fiori/UI5/Odata/ABAP developerResponsibilities:
- Migration of WebDynpro Java applications from portal 7.02 to portal 7.31
- Customized the Kraft Portal Logon page with Kraft theme
- Created custom css files to make the logon page compatible with chrome and mozilla browsers
- Created different portal themes & desktops for Kraft Internal users and external vendors.
- Created a custom code to extract all BW Bookmarks and their properties using KM APIs.
- Created an inventory list with system details of all the iviews and their delta links the existing portals.
- Created custom workflows using SAP BPM
- Creation of webservices using EJBs
- Creation of custom methods for MDM records using MDM Java APIs
- Creation of methods to perform CRUD operations for tables in SQL
Confidential
Java/Fiori/UI5/Odata/ABAP developerResponsibilities:
- Worked with MDM APIs to fetch data from MDM to portal
- Worked with Java mail API to trigger email notifications
- Worked with SAP MDM tools (MDM data manager, MDM console)
- Involved in the testing phase
- Onsite Co-ordination and client interaction
Confidential
Java/Fiori/UI5/Odata/ABAP developerResponsibilities:
- Involved in understanding of the Aris system template, which had information about the Portal structure, based on which the client portal was modeled.
- Solely responsible for converting Aris data into portal compatible xml using 3rd party tool.
- Different xml's schemas were created for each portal object, including delta links.
- Involved in the testing and CR raised in HP QC
- Onsite Co-ordination and client interaction.
Confidential
Java/Fiori/UI5/Odata/ABAP developerResponsibilities:
- Interacted with IS and IT architects of the client to understand their existing IT landscape and HR services
- Part of the team, involved in creating a POC(Mockup) to demonstrate the standard ESS/MSS functionality to the client
- Contributed in documentation of the High Level Portal Design and Implementation Guidelines document.
- Complied documents for the client portal look and feel, security and governance of the portal
- Worked on complete customization of ESS & MSS applications
- Was responsible for creating a 2 level hierarchical structure, to display the direct reports of a manager
- Worked with Adaptive RFC models to access the backend
- Worked on Adobe Interactive forms
- Worked on Object Value Selector ( Confidential )
- Compile technical specifications, develop code, and compile Unit Test Plans in addition to carrying out unit testing of the developed code.
Confidential
Java/Fiori/UI5/Odata/ABAP developerResponsibilities:
- Was responsible for the Development and maintenance of portal content
- Was responsible for customization of Self Service Applications in NWDI using Web Dynpro Java and Floor Plan Manager
- Worked with Adaptive RFC models to access the backend.
- Printing Web Dynpro Table UI contents
- Creating transport for migration to various servers.
- Compile technical specifications, develop code, and compile Unit Test Plans in addition to carrying out unit testing of the developed code
- Coordinating with onsite/offshore for ensuring timeliness and quality of deliverables
- Documenting technical specifications in the Solution Manager.
Confidential
Java/Fiori/UI5/Odata/ABAP developerResponsibilities:
- Coordinating with client onsite for ensuring timeliness and quality of deliverables.
- Involved in the development and maintenance the Portal, which included creation of Iviews, pages, worksets and roles in the PCD.
- Creating transport requests for migration of portal content to different servers.
- Testing and Customer Documentation.
- Conduct problem analysis and communicate the solution to the user using HP’s clarify tool
- Creation of transaction codes(tcodes).
- Creating and editing Data Dictionary Objects like tables, data elements and domains.
- Creation of search helps.
- Used Code Checkers such as SLIN and YSR01(extended code eheccker) for objects.
